Day 01: Bangalore - Chikmagalur
Our representative will greet you in Bangalore and drive you to Chikmagalur, renowned for its hill stations and famously known as the coffee land of Karnataka. Chikmagalur is blessed with stunning mountain ranges, beautiful valleys, and meticulously maintained gardens, offering tourists a delightful visual experience. Upon arrival in Chikmagalur, check into the hotel and proceed to visit Seethalayanagiri and Mullayanagiri. Mullayanagiri, the highest peak in Karnataka, is located in the Bababudangiri range, standing at 6,330 ft (1,930 meters), and is considered the highest peak between the Himalayas and Nilgiris. (Vehicles can reach Seethalayanagiri, and a short trek is required to reach Mullayanagiri.) Return to Chikmagalur, and on the way, enjoy a hot cup of Chikmagalur coffee at SIRI Coffee. Head back to the hotel for an overnight stay.
Day 02: Chikmagalur - Sringeri - Kalasa
In the morning, after breakfast, check out of the hotel and drive to Sringeri, home to the Sringeri Sharada Peeta, the first mutt established by Jagadguru Sri Adishankara (Shankaracharya), located on the banks of the Tunga River. Sringeri hosts several historic temples. Upon arrival, visit the Sri Sharadamba temple to offer prayers to the Goddess of Knowledge and receive her blessings. Then, explore the nearby Sri Vidyashankara temple and other shrines within the temple complex. You can have lunch at the temple dining hall. Continue the journey to Kalasa, enjoying the breathtaking beauty of Kudremukh National Park along the way. Kalasa, a picturesque town in the Western Ghats of Chikmagalur district, is blessed with stunning hills, rivers, valleys, viewpoints, waterfalls, forests, coffee and tea estates, and temples. It is a significant filming location in Karnataka, with many South Indian movies shot here. Upon arrival in Kalasa, check into the hotel and relax. In the evening, visit the Kalaseshwara Temple on the banks of the Bhadra River, where the Shiva linga was installed by Sage Agasthya along with a silver dome. Return to the hotel for an overnight stay.
Day 03: Kalasa - Kudremukh National Park - Udupi
After breakfast, check out of the hotel and head to the beautiful Tea Estate at Samse, located 10 km from Kalasa. The tea estate is a scenic location where nature has spread a lush green carpet. The Sri Sarva Siddhi Ganapathy temple in the middle of the estate enhances the beauty of the place, making one feel embraced by nature and divinity. Spend some time enjoying the natural beauty before driving to Udupi, a major tourist and temple town in coastal Karnataka. Along the way, admire the stunning landscape of Kudremukh National Park and visit Karkala, known for the 41.5-foot monolithic statue of Gommateshwara (Lord Bahubali), the second tallest in Karnataka. Upon arrival in Udupi, check into the hotel and visit Malpe Beach for a panoramic view. Malpe, about 6 km from Udupi, is a natural harbor and an important fishing center with a beautiful beach. Later, visit St. Mary's Island (closed during the monsoon season), which is 300m long and 100m wide with a few palm trees. Enjoy a walk on Malpe Beach before visiting the Sri Krishna Temple, a renowned Hindu temple dedicated to Lord Krishna and Dvaita Matha in Udupi. The temple is one of the most famous pilgrimage sites. Return to the hotel for an overnight stay.
Day 04: Udupi - Moodbidri - Mangalore
In the morning, after breakfast, check out of the hotel and drive to Kunjarugiri, a village in Udupi known for Durga Betta, a hill with a Durga temple. The idol was installed by Parashurama. After receiving divine blessings, continue to Moodbidri, an important Jainism center with several Jain temples. Visit the Thousand Pillars Temple (Saavira Kambada Basadi), the most ornate Jain temple in the region, built in 1430 A.D. The temple houses a 2.5-meter tall bronze image of Lord Chandranatha Swami, considered sacred. Proceed to Mangalore, known as the gateway to Karnataka, nestled between the Arabian Sea and the Western Ghats. En route, visit Pilikula Nisargadhama, a zoo and theme park with various wild animals, offering a rejuvenating experience for nature lovers, botanists, zoologists, and students. The park features a zoo, botanical garden, water park, science center, and artisan village. Upon arrival in Mangalore, check into the hotel and visit Panambur Beach, popular for its scenic sunsets, beautiful port area, and as a picnic spot. Panambur Beach is known for its cleanliness and safety, offering activities like jet skiing, boating, and dolphin viewing. Return to the hotel for an overnight stay.
Day 05: Mangalore - Bangalore
After breakfast, check out of the hotel and drive back to Bangalore. Upon arrival, you will be transferred to a designated point in Bangalore. The trip concludes with delightful memories of the Chikmagalur - Sringeri - Kalasa - Udupi - Mangalore Tour Package.

Best Time to Visit
The ideal time to visit this region is from October to March when the weather is pleasant and perfect for sightseeing. The monsoon season, from June to September, brings heavy rainfall, which may hinder travel plans but also enhances the lush greenery of the landscape.
